Abstract

The invention discloses a greening method of a cement mortar anchoring and shotcreting side slope, comprising the steps of paving root-system induction holes on the cleaned cement anchoring and shotcreting side slope; setting ecological rods along the contour line; paving and anchoring vegetation cushions, ecological rods and geotechnique grille nets in ecologic rod lattices; and then spraying and sowing vegetation base layers and seed layers, finally covering vegetation blankets. Through the method, the cement mortar anchoring and shotcreting side slope is greened, so that the weathering and stripping of the cement mortar layer exposed in air for a long period can be avoided; the protection effect of the side slope engineering can be enhanced; and the long-time stability and safety of the slope surface can be ensured; meanwhile, the method solves the problem that the artificial planting layer on the cement mortar anchoring and shotcreting slope is eroded by rainfall to slip, fall off and the like, so that the stability of the planting layer can be ensured and a stable base is ecologically provided to the slope vegetation.

Of the present inventionly plant that to give birth to pad be that pad is given birth in conventional used the planting in this area, form, sew up the formation cushion through the graticule mode by domatic water draining and accumulating layer, greening substrate layer and surface coating.Domatic water draining and accumulating layer is processed by the water permeability composite material, surface coating is made up of the natural plant fibre net, but is natural degradation.The present invention lays to plant on side slope and gives birth to pad, and pad is given birth in this plantation can increase roughness, improves the adhesive strength of planting living substrate layer.Simultaneously; Can retain, dredge the interflow in the planting layer effectively; Promote the unnecessary precipitation that penetrates in the planting layer to discharge fast, effectively reduce the lubrication of domatic of planting layer and anchor spray, and can store a certain amount of rainfall; Strengthen domatic base material stability, effectively improve the slope vegetation growth conditions.
Ecology used among the present invention is excellent, and it is processed by non-degradable plastics (PP) material, has good flexible and tensile strength, has the permeable soil characteristics of not passing through simultaneously.Can process the tubulose (bag shape) of different size according to actual demands of engineering, filling has good physicochemical property in it, satisfies the living base material of planting of plant growing needs.In engineering is used, can play auxiliary reinforcement (sash) effect, carry out small classification to domatic simultaneously, can effectively alleviate rainfall washing away domatic planting layer.
The used earth work grille net of the present invention is processed by non-degradable plastics (PE, PP) material, and general mesh size is 4cm * 4cm.Have good flexible and tensile strength, in engineering, play reinforced action, guarantee that planting living substrate layer adheres in domatic long-term stability.
The present invention is used plants living base material, and it is the core material of slope greening technology, is that media base and the required moisture of plant growing, the nutrient of plant life continues the source supplied.Mainly formulated by materials such as organic compost, inorganic mineral, soil, an agent, water-loss reducer, slow-release fertilizers.And the conventional method that living matrix is this area is planted in preparation, and those skilled in the art can prepare the living matrix of planting of variety classes and different proportionings as required.Used material also all can commercially availablely obtain.

Embodiment 1
With method of the present invention cement mortar anchor spray side slope in one place is afforested, specific as follows:
(1) the cement mortar side slope surface is cleared up, the place that domatic detrition is serious is removed or is reinforced, and cleans domatic.
(2) root system is set induces the hole, aperture 15cm, degree of depth 20cm, about 5/m domatic boring with hammer drill 2It is that root system of plant provides certain wider space that these root systems are induced the hole, forms three-dimensional protection, improves the solid native ability of root system of plant.
(3) be that the isohypse of 1.5m is holed the general 20cm of drilling depth, aperture 3cm on domatic along spacing; Insert the long 80cm that is, diameter is the anchor pole of 15mm and with the cement mortar anchoring of being in the milk, and is provided with above the anchor pole exposed parts that the PP material processes; Living matrix is planted in filling; Diameter is the ecological rod of 10cm, and ecological rod is fixed on the anchor pole, forms horizontal ecological excellent sash.
(4) living pad is planted in laying in the excellent sash of domatic ecology, and fixes with rivet, plants and gives birth to pad laying in a triangle, and transverse lap is tight, vertically suitably reserves the bolthole position according to the anchoring requirement.
(5) lay earth work grille net, and with anchor pole with earth work grille net, plant give birth to pad anchor at tightly domatic on.
(6) plant the construction of sowing grass seeds by duster of living base material on this basis, require substrate layer to sow grass seeds by duster evenly, thickness is about 9cm.
(7) then, sow grass seeds by duster again be mixed with vegetable seeds substrate layer as seed layer, thickness is about 3cm.
(8) surface coverage vegetation blanket plays windproof, soil moisture conservation effect, helps emerging of vegetable seeds.
(9) according to the view needs, suitably carry out manual work and make that scape and plant are auxiliary to be planted, promote the slope landscape effect.
(10) construction finishes, and gets into the engineering maintenance stage in early stage.
Construct after half a year, observe cement mortar anchor spray side slope, vegetation is stable, and substrate layer does not have sheet to come off and integral slipping, dark green, the dense vegetation of face of land a slice, and coverage surpasses 98%, and afforestation effect is obvious.
